To trap with a 2-3 zone, have your guards cover the point guard once he gets a few feet past midcourt. At that point, both guards should move in for the trap. While this is happening, your forwards must sprint toward players in the wings. The point guard should throw up a pass that your forwards can easily steal.

If you are assigned to defend someone bigger than you are, try staying in the passing lane between your man and the current ball handler. This keeps them from grabbing a pass and shooting over you.

Your position both before and after a rebound can help determine whether or not you keep the ball. Jump with both feet for improved power and balance and retrieve the ball using both hands. Once you have the basketball, come down to the ground with your legs spread out to make sure you don’t stumble.
